Isaiah 62:2
And the Gentiles shall see thy righteousness, and all kings thy glory: and thou shalt be called by a new name, which the mouth of the Lord shall name.
Context
This verse from Isaiah Chapter 62 connects to 10 cross-references. Isaiah will not be silent until Jerusalem's salvation shines like a bright torch. She will have a new name: Hephzibah — my delight is in her. The Lord delights in her as a bridegroom in his bride. A highway will …
